Quick way to grow Minestrone Soup flavor in 3 steps

This recipe provides a quick and efficient method to enhance the flavor of your minestrone soup in just three simple steps. Perfect for a weeknight meal, it delivers a rich and satisfying taste.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ings 4 people
Calories 250 kcal

Equipment

  • Large pot
  • Wooden spoon

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 1 tbsp Olive oil
  • 2 cloves Garlic minced
  • 1 can Diced tomatoes 14.5 oz
  • 4 cups Vegetable broth
  • 0.5 cup Small pasta
  • 1 can Canned cannellini beans rinsed and drained
  • 2 cups Fresh spinach

Flavor Enhancers

  • 1 piece Parmesan rind optional
  • 0.25 cup Fresh basil chopped

Seasoning

  • 0.5 tsp Salt
  • 0.25 tsp Black pepper

Instructions
 

Step 1: Sauté Aromatics

  • Heat olive oil in a large pot and sauté minced garlic until fragrant, about 1 minute.

Step 2: Build the Base

  • Add diced tomatoes, vegetable broth, and parmesan rind (if using) to the pot. Bring to a simmer for 10 minutes to allow flavors to meld.

Step 3: Finish and Serve

  • Stir in small pasta, cannellini beans, and spinach. Cook until pasta is al dente, then remove the parmesan rind, stir in fresh basil, salt, and pepper.

Notes

For an extra layer of flavor, consider adding a splash of red wine with the diced tomatoes. You can also adjust the vegetables to your preference, using zucchini or green beans. Fresh herbs like oregano or thyme would also be a great addition to the sautéing step for a more complex aroma.
